Were seeking a strategic delivery-focused Sr. Product Director to lead our Payments and Fraud capabilities. You will own all of the journeys of our payment and fraud workstreamsfrom Cashier UI/UX Customer Intelligence Platform Routing and Orchestration Finance and Risk Engine while driving major improvements in platform reliability card acceptance fraud monitoring and cost reduction. You have the strategy and leadership to thrive in complex environments understand the nuances of payments and fraud and can build scalable systems that support growth and compliance to create fast and easy onboarding experiences which delight our customers while maintaining our operational excellence.

This position sits at the intersection of Growth Compliance Risk Fraud Payments Marketing/Martech Engineering Data Science UX Research and Customer Operations. Youll define the product strategy and roadmap lead a team of Product Managers and drive measurable impact across growth trust and operational efficiency.



Responsibilities
  • Lead the product strategy and roadmap for our Payments and Risk Platforms. Your ownership vision and ability to deliver will directly impact several KPIs such as:
    • Payment transactions including deposit and withdrawals
    • Product Fraud and risk mitigation
    • Transaction integrity and intelligence
    • Treasury settlements and reconciliation
    • Operational dashboards data and reporting
  • Monitor adjust and improve payment success rates reduce friction and optimize payment routing.
  • Cultivate strategic alignment across Risk Compliance and Finance to ensure safe compliant and scalable operations.
  • Communicate clear data backed recommendations and tradeoffs to senior leadership
  • Build monitor and communicate results of real-time visibility into funnel health and account outcomes (dashboards leading indicators anomaly detection alerting)
  • Champion a customer first research driven culture while balancing risk/fraud and regulatory constraints
  • Build a collaborative team culture that encourages open communication innovation and career growth while holding Product Managers accountable and striving for excellence


Qualifications
  • 10 years in years developing successful digital products including 5 years managing Product Managers
  • Expertise in designing launching and optimizing large-scale Payment and Fraud platforms in highly regulated (AML) digital industries (e.g. online gaming fintech banking payments identity)
  • Expertise in creating andmaintaining roadmaps while also training direct reports on best practices
  • Ability to write descriptive narratives which demonstrate your knowledge of the problem strategies risks and data which helped formulate the proposed solution or feature
  • Track record of leading and delivering large-scale products from conception through to completion
  • Proven ability to engage Data Scientists and ML teams on predictive or automated capabilities
  • Experience in Agile software product delivery preferably in a scrum setting usingJira
  • Expertise in funnel analytics experimentation and data-driven product development
  • Executive level communication and storytelling to offer effective updates and streamline communication to a broad audience

ADDITIONAL REQUIREMENTS

  • Experience with vendor orchestration model monitoring and risk decisioning platforms
  • Background building platform capabilities (rules engines feature stores experimentation frameworks)

The salary range for this position is $150000.00 - $212750.00 USD which is dependent on a several factors including relevant experience geography business needs and market demand. This role may offer the following benefits: medical vision and dental insurance; life insurance; disability insurance; a 401(k)-matching program; among other employee benefits. This role may also be eligible for short-term or long-term incentive compensation including but not limited to cash bonuses and stock program participation. This role includes paid Flexible Time Off and paid company holidays.
